The Brno rider who amused the world: the statue of Jošt turns ten

Photo: Czech Television

In the very heart of Brno, the Czech Republic’s second-largest city, a monumental equestrian statue of Margrave Jošt of Luxembourg has stood since 2015. The eight-meter-tall bronze sculpture by acclaimed Czech artist Jaroslav Róna was meant to honor courage—one of the four classical virtues symbolically represented on Moravské náměstí. Instead, it became a viral sensation.

While the artist intended a modern interpretation of a classic equestrian monument, the public saw it differently.
